Liverpool Shipwreck And Humane Society
To assist in the saving of human life in cases of shipwreck, fire and other dangers, in the North West.To recognize the actions of persons instrumental in saving, or attempting to save human life from danger, by the granting of medals, parchments and certificates.To encourage the teaching of techniques and methods of rescue and lifesaving on land, sea and in the air.

Mid Pennine Search And Rescue Organisation
Saving of livesThe Mid Pennine Search and Rescue Organisation (MPSRO) serves as a representative body for the five independent Mountain Rescue teams in the Mid Pennine Region, namely; Bolton Mountain Rescue Team, Bowland Pennine Mountain Rescue Team, Rossendale and Pendle Mountain Rescue Team, Calder Valley Search and Rescue Team and Holme Valley Mountain Rescue Team.
